pow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/ усеч файл embeded firebird 2.5
20 сообщений из 20, страница 1 из 1
усеч файл embeded firebird 2.5
    #38723981
Wizard2007
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Здравствуйте, использую FireBird Embedded 2.5 файл базы данных после добавления новых записей вырос, а после удаления не у уменьшился. Есть ли команды для «оптимизации» занимаемого файлом места. Что то на подобии shrink в MS SQL Server?

В мире где каждый второй гений было бы страшно жить, поэтому я живу без страха.
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38723984
Таблоид
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Wizard2007,

только вот это:

gbak -b yourfile.fdb yourfile.fbk
+
gbak -c yourfile.fbk new_yourfile.fdb
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38724035
Фотография roadster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Wizard2007Есть ли команды для «оптимизации» занимаемого файлом места.зачем?
Таблоид правильно сказал, только после рестора.
но зачем? у вас там локальная БД террабайты занимает?
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725128
Фотография Gallemar
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
roadsterWizard2007Есть ли команды для «оптимизации» занимаемого файлом места.зачем?
Таблоид правильно сказал, только после рестора.
но зачем? у вас там локальная БД террабайты занимает?
Каждому пришедшему с MS SQL хочется иметь механизм уменьшения размера БД после чистки:)
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725229
Фотография roadster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
GallemarКаждому пришедшему с MS SQL хочется иметь механизм уменьшения размера БД после чистки:)а зачем это в MS SQL использовать?
если автоматом, то понятно, пусть делается.
на мой взгляд уменьшение размера БД после чистки скорее способно несколько затормозить дальнейшую работу с БД в связи с необходимостью выделения нового места под данные и увеличением размера БД. хотя при современном уровне развития оборудования - это непринципиальный вопрос.
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725237
Фотография Gallemar
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
roadster,не знаю :) Иногда нужно на ходу подрезать базу,например после ОЧЕНЬ большого кол-ва записей. У меня такое было раз, с 16Гб база сжалась до 2Гб.
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725357
Фотография roadster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
GallemarИногда нужно на ходу подрезать базу,например после ОЧЕНЬ большого кол-ва записей.кому как.
по мне, так можно и отложить на плановое обслуживание, благо размеры современных носителей позволяют.
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725366
Фотография Gallemar
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
roadster,не поверишь - многие не знают что такое backup-restore для БД. Особенно этим страдают программисты MS SQL и 1С, для вторых это вообще из области шаманства.
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725423
Фотография roadster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Gallemarмногие не знают что такое backup-restore для БД. Особенно этим страдают программисты MS SQLздесь вопрос философский.
программист БД не обязан быть ДБА.
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725438
Фотография Gallemar
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
roadsterGallemarмногие не знают что такое backup-restore для БД. Особенно этим страдают программисты MS SQLздесь вопрос философский.
программист БД не обязан быть ДБА.
Угу,но такие вещи должен понимать. Наблюдал случаи когда вызывали программиста из-за проблем с программой и начиналось: отключите антивирус,отключите файервол,переустановите винду,поменяйте сервер,страну,вероисповедание...
Хотя надо банально сделать выгрузку в dt и обратно.
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725445
Фотография roadster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
GallemarУгу,но такие вещи должен понимать.не обязательно.
зачем заморачиваться с рестором, если всё работает? когда же администрированием БД занимаются отдельные люди, нет смысла вообще в это вникать. достаточно знать, что есть такие вещи как бэкапы и из них можно восстановить БД в случае сбоя.
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725446
Фотография Gallemar
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
roadster когда же администрированием БД занимаются отдельные люди
В случае 1с - программист 1с "Сам себе режиссер", работал в 1с франче - 95 % клиентов - БД на 1-2 компа.
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725455
Фотография roadster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
GallemarВ случае 1с - программист 1с "Сам себе режиссер", работал в 1с франче - 95 % клиентов - БД на 1-2 компа.и что?
хороших программистов 1С мало, у нас в регионе они как правило не работают на франчей, а работают либо на себя (ведя 3-4 средних конторы), либо в крупной конторе на большие (по местным меркам) деньги. у франчей, как правило, работают на мелкие конторы студенты.
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725461
Фотография roadster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Gallemar,

а ещё франчи для приличных и денежных проектов нанимают по договору подряда сотрудников, которые приходят на пару часов 2-3 раза в неделю и делают 80% всего объёма работ. в остальное время штатные сотрудники как-то покрывают оставшиеся 20% работ. наша контора через это прошла :)
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725467
Фотография Gallemar
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
roadsterхороших программистов 1С мало
Согласен
roadsterу нас в регионе они как правило не работают на франчей
где,если не секрет?
roadsterу франчей, как правило, работают на мелкие конторы студенты.
Не обязательно,видел людей работающих по 10 лет с 1с.
В общем, мнения у нас расходятся, но переубеждать тебя я не буду. Не факт что я прав :)
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725475
Фотография roadster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Gallemarгде,если не секрет?Нижегородская область.
GallemarНе обязательно,видел людей работающих по 10 лет с 1с.всё может быть, но я сталкивался с франчами только как с внедренцами.
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725482
Фотография Gallemar
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
roadsterGallemar,

а ещё франчи для приличных и денежных проектов нанимают по договору подряда сотрудников, которые приходят на пару часов 2-3 раза в неделю и делают 80% всего объёма работ. в остальное время штатные сотрудники как-то покрывают оставшиеся 20% работ. наша контора через это прошла :)
Ужас.
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725579
Фотография roadster
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
GallemarУжас.почему?
по подобной схеме работает масса внедренцев не только в 1С. главное выиграть тендер/заключить договор.
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725723
Wizard2007
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ТаблоидWizard2007,

только вот это:

gbak -b yourfile.fdb yourfile.fbk
+
gbak -c yourfile.fbk new_yourfile.fdb

спасибо это было то что надо
...
Рейтинг: 0 / 0
усеч файл embeded firebird 2.5
    #38725730
Фотография kdv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
- надо усечь
- усек?
- усек!
...
Рейтинг: 0 / 0
20 сообщений из 20, страница 1 из 1
Форумы / Firebird, InterBase [игнор отключен] [закрыт для гостей] / усеч файл embeded firebird 2.5
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]